Butterfield incorporated in Cayman in November 1967

22 November 1967

Butterfield in Cayman incorporated

Butterfield is a well-known name in the Cayman Islands, a retail bank that has locations in Governor’s Square, Camana Bay, Midtown Plaza in George Town and its head office in central George Town at One Butterfield Place. It incorporated in the Cayman islands on 22 November 1967 as Bank of NT Butterfield (Cayman) Limited and offered trust and corporate services to both residents and non-residents alike, under the stewardship of Managing Director Peter Tompkins. In 1989, it merged with Washington Bank and Trust Company Ltd and doubled its staff overnight. The merger allowed the new entity to offer a comprehensive range of banking and trust facilities, growing into the important banking presence that it is today.



23 November 1935

GT radio station opened

The George Town radio station opened on this day to a huge crowd of people gathered in central George Town. It functioned as a means of relaying meteorological reports as well as providing two-way telephone and telegraph communications.
